Equalizer, Balance And Fade
To adjust the Audio settings:
1. Push the + MORE button on the faceplate, then press the “Settings” button on the touch-
screen.
2. Scroll down and press the “Audio button on the touchscreen to open the Audio menu.
The Audio Menu shows the following options for you to customize your audio settings.
Equalizer
Press the “Equalizer” button on the touchscreen to adjust the Bass, Mid and Treble. Use the “+”
or “–” button on the touchscreen to adjust the equalizer to your desired settings. Press the
“back arrow” button on the touchscreen when done.
Balance/Fade
Press the “Balance/Fade” button on the touchscreen to adjust the sound from the speakers.
Use the “arrow” button on the touchscreen to adjust the sound level from the front and rear or
right and left side speakers. Press the Center “C button on the touchscreen to reset the
balance and fade to the factory setting. Press the “back arrow” button on the touchscreen
when done.
Speed Adjustable
Press the “Speed Adjusted Volume button on the touchscreen to select between OFF, 1, 2 or
3. This will decrease the radio volume relative to a decrease in vehicle speed. Press the “back
arrow” button on the touchscreen when done.
Loudness
Press the “Loudness” button on the touchscreen to select the Loudness feature. When this
feature is activated it improves sound quality at lower volumes. Press the “back arrow” button
on the touchscreen when done.
Radio Operation
Seek Up /Seek Down
Press the up or down button to seek through radio stations in AM, FM or SXM bands.
Hold either button to bypass stations without stopping.
Store Radio Presets Manually
The Radio stores up to 12 presets in each of the Radio modes. Four presets are visible at the top
of the radio screen. Pressing the “All” button on the touchscreen on the radio home screen will
display all of the preset stations for that mode.
